The Rotary Club of Cambridge was founded in 1922; this comng year we will be celebratiing our Centennial! Our club, like all Rotary Clubs throughout the world, encourages and fosters the ideal of service above self. Our goal is to build a better world, emphasizing service activities by individuals and groups that enhance the quality of life and human dignity, encouraging high ethical standards and creating peace in the world. A great many local non-profits have benefited from the Cambridge Rotary's contributions over the last 90 years. Here is a sample of the organizations that have received funds recently:
Major Beneficiaries
- Our Place at the Salvation Army - Annual Holiday Party for homeless children, with gifts for all and a visit from Santa Claus
- National Honor Society at Cambridge Rindge & Latin, Community Charter School of Cambridge and Prospect Hill Academy - $6,000 in scholarships annually at award breakfast for members of the Society
- Dictionaries presented to all 3rd graders in Cambridge Public Schools
- Equity and Inclusion book for all elementary school classes in Cambridge Public Schools
- Sponsorship of 25 girls in rural Bangladesh to attend school through Distressed Children Intl
- Rotary Youth Leadership Academy - leadership training for promising youth
- Innovators 4 Purpose - curriculum materials for STEM tutoring and I Pads for educational use
- Furnishing Hope- furniture drive and household donations for families coming out of homelessness
